GENERAL SUMMARY:
The Ophthalmic Technician (Certified or Non-Certified) performs a range of duties which includes preparing the patient for the provider (preliminary exam, medical history, & testing), preparation of examination and treatment rooms, performing basic and routine vision screening examinations, administering eye medications, cleaning and maintaining ophthalmic instruments and assisting physicians during minor surgical and laser procedures.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:
Provides primary ophthalmic care to patients and act as clinical assistant to physician.
Performs complete ophthalmic history and preliminary exams, sub-specialty tests (refraction, VF test, A-Scan Biometry (IOL master), Pachymetry, PAM evaluation, color testing, and contact lens evaluation).
Verifies patient information by interviewing patient, recording medical history, and confirming purpose of visit. Accurately records all information in EMR system according to established standards and physician requirements.
Checks condition of patients' eyes by observing pupils, muscle, visual acuity, extraocular movements, and blood pressure (if requested by Physician).
Prepares patients for ophthalmology examination by dilating pupils, changes in visual acuity, elevated extraocular pressure, or blood pressure and communicating results to Attending Physician.
Secures patient information and maintains patient confidence by completing and safeguarding medical records, completing diagnostic and procedure coding, and keeping patient information confidential.
Counsels patients by transmitting physician's orders, use of drops, contact lenses, drugs, and answer questions about surgery and specialty imagining required/ordered.
Maintains safe, secure, and healthy work environment by establishing and following standards and procedures along with complying with legal regulations.
Keeps equipment operating by following operating instructions, troubleshooting breakdowns, maintaining supplies, performing preventive maintenance, and promptly reporting equipment issues.
Processes prescription refill requests.
Performs set standard number of patient work-ups based on established times while maintaining quality of customer service.
Maintains stock in exam room in accordance to standard inventory and physician preferences.
Maintains minor procedure stock and all sterilization of instruments.
Sets up and prep for minor procedures to include setting sterile tray and maintaining sterile field.

Role overview:
We focus on managed care within the payor space, commonly referred to as medical economics. The team works with major insurance providers such as Blue Cross, Aetna, Cigna, and other key players in the market. We collaborate with negotiators who engage with payors to establish new reimbursement rates and build rate structures for future periods.
Job Description:
Researches and analyzes managed care data from various financial systems and interface tools.
Performs complex and varied healthcare data analysis, including financial modeling and risk forecasting.
Identifies and implements improvements in quality control and timeliness of reporting.
Extracts, collects, analyzes, and interprets health utilization and financial data.
Interprets and analyzes data from various sources using knowledge of healthcare managed care contracts and administrative claims data.
Key Responsibilities
Rate Structure Development: Build and analyze reimbursement rate structures for upcoming years.
Data Analysis & Modeling: Pull 1-2 years of historical data and use Excel to model trends and methodologies, including stop-loss and per diem models.
Forecasting: Project future reimbursement rates and financial impacts based on historical data, market trends, and modeling assumptions.
Financial Analysis: Evaluate monetary impacts and account-level details to support decision-making.
Contract Review: Interpret payor contract language and translate reimbursement terms into formulas for financial modeling.
Market Insight: Stay informed on active contracts and payor trends to guide negotiations and rate-setting strategies.
